#417385 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#417385 is composed of 25.5% red, 45.1%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.1% cyan, 13.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 195.9 degrees, a saturation of 34.3% and a lightness of 38.8%. #417385 color hex could be obtained by blending #82e6ff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#417385 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#417385 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#417385 has RGB values of R:65, G:115,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 4289413.
